Job Description:

The Polymer Institute in the College of Engineering is seeking a highly motivated Research Scientist to join its research team in June 2025. The Research Scientist will work on research projects within the Polymer Institute in the College of Engineering. This position performs research tasks using polymer synthesis/processing equipment, additive manufacturing equipment and various characterization instruments. The employee must be self-directed and able to work with minimum supervision. The employee must also be able to document results and write quarterly/yearly progress reports to granting agencies. The candidate will be expected to perform laboratory experiments in support of funded projects, perform laboratory experiments to develop new areas of research, perform analysis of samples, develop new protocols, interpret results, write manuscripts for publication in refereed journals, and write/assist with preparation of grant proposals. In addition, this position will assist the Sr. Director in running day-to-day operations of the Polymer Institute. Experience in supervising laboratory experiments of graduate and undergraduate students is highly desired.

The initial appointment will be for one year and may be renewed based on need, availability of funding, employee performance, and other factors.

Minimum Qualifications:


1. A Ph.D. in Polymer/Biomedical/Mechanical/Manufacturing/Chemical Engineering or closely related field
2. At least 1-3 years of experience in additive manufacturing (FDM technology) and polymer processing (compounding and extrusion)
3. At least 1-3 years of experience using characterization equipment for thermal analysis (DSC, TGA, DMA), FTIR, SEM and Rheology
4. Knowledge of CAD tools such SolidWorks, Simplify 3D, G-codes
5. Experience in writing manuscripts and supervising laboratory experiments of graduate and undergraduate students

Preferred Qualifications:

1. 2-3 years of polymers processing and/or additive manufacturing experience
2. Publications in peer-reviewed journals is a plus
3. The ability to generate new ideas for research and write grant proposals preferred
